Understanding the compensation structure is an essential part of deciding which broker-dealer investment firm to join. San Diego, CA 92121-3091, SEC Share Class Initiative and Settlement, Contact LPL: (800) 877-7210 Advisors who work at an independent RIA or broker-dealer aren't incentivized to recommend a particular product over another, and so have the freedom to recommend investment products based on their clients' best interest. As an independent advisor, you'll receive a payout from 80% to 100% (before admin fees and ticket charges). Advisors who manage their clients' assets themselves often pay 10-30 basis points on client assets for billing, statements, and performance reporting.
